Meatball soup has a long and diverse culinary history. Nearly every cuisine boasts its own variation: Italian wedding soup with delicate meatballs and greens, Mexican albóndigas simmered in tomato broth with herbs and rice, Asian-inspired versions featuring ginger and scallions, and Eastern European renditions enriched with root vegetables and fresh dill. From a chef’s perspective, the magic of this soup lies in layering flavors. It typically starts with aromatics—onions, garlic, perhaps leeks—gently sautéed to release their natural sweetness. This foundation sets the tone for the entire dish. Once the broth is added, whether it’s clear beef stock, chicken broth, or even a tomato-infused base, the flavors begin building complexity. As the meatballs cook directly in the liquid, they enrich the broth further, making it robust and savory without the need for excessive seasoning.

Texture also plays a crucial role. Perfect meatballs should be tender, not tough. Achieving that softness often involves using binders like breadcrumbs and eggs, and handling the mixture gently. Overmixing can lead to dense meatballs, while careful mixing keeps them light and succulent. When done right, each bite almost melts in your mouth, contrasting beautifully with the silky broth.

Prep Time 20 minutes mins
Cook Time 40 minutes mins
Total Time 1 hour hr
Course Main Course
Cuisine American
Servings 8 people
Calories 263.5 kcal

Ingredients
 
 

  • Green Onions Isolated On White2 bunches green onions (scallions or green shallots) - chopped
  • Vegetable Oil2 tablespoons vegetable oil
  • Green Chili Pepper1 can green chilis (green chilli in British English) - chopped
  • Crushed Tomatoes1 can passata or crushed tomatoes (tomato puree with seeds removed)
  • Oregano (Origanum Vulgare) Leaves1 tablespoon oregano
  • Dried Garlic1 teaspoon garlic powder
  • Wooden Bowl Of Salt1 teaspoon salt
  • Mint Fresh And Dried8 pieces dried mint
  • Ground Cumin1 teaspoon cumin
  • Store Of Fresh Water1- quart water
  • Raw Meat Mince2 pounds ground beef (minced beef)
  • Chicken Egg2 medium egg
  • Pile Of Flour Isolated On White Background½ cup all purpose flour (plain flour Australia and UK)
  • Wooden Bowl Of Salt½ teaspoon salt
  • Ground Black Pepper Pile, Paths, Top½ teaspoon ground black pepper
  • Dried Garlic½ teaspoon garlic powder

Instructions
 

  • Heat oil in a pot, then add onions until it caramelizes. Add tomatoes, chiles, and seasonings. Pour water and bring to a boil. Cover and let it simmer for 10 minutes.
  • While waiting for the water to boil, mix lean ground beef, eggs, flour, salt, pepper, and half a teaspoon of garlic powder. Form into a ball as you desired sizes. Slowly drop the balls into the soup individually while letting the soup continue to boil. When all the ingredients are added, turn off the heat and serve it while hot. Don’t forget to taste first to adjust the seasoning.
